FELL FROM OVERHEAD BRIDGE
RELIEF WORKER SUCCUMBS TO INJURIES.
(By Telegraph —Press Association.) TAUMARUNUI, This - Day. When Hugh Riley, a relief worker, was returning to camp from Ohura on Saturday, ho missed his step and fell from an overhead bridge to the road below, sustaining injuries from which he died half an hour later.
